按键精灵9输入框内容调用

我举例子,我做了一个如下的循环脚本,就是从1开始输入,一直到100Fori=1to100SayStringCStr(i)Delay200KeyPress"Enter",1... 我举例子,我做了一个如下的循环脚本,就是从1开始输入,一直到100
For i=1 to 100
SayString CStr(i)
Delay 200
KeyPress "Enter", 1
Next
现在我想在界面创建个输入框,让在里面输入的数字能代替1,就是说我在输入框里面输入20,再保存,然后脚本启动就会从20一直写到100。
求高手帮忙,具体步骤请告诉我,谢谢
展开
 我来答
刺友互
高粉答主

2020-03-30 · 每个回答都超有意思的
知道答主
回答量:3979
采纳率:100%
帮助的人:69.8万
展开全部

1、打开按键精灵,新建一个带界面的脚本脚本。

2、选择界面,然后选择输入框,可以便于数据的显示和用户自己输入数据

3、在界面上画出一个可以随时调节大小和位置的文本输入框,右边是它的一些数据信息,可以把“输入框1”这几个字去掉。

4、界面画好后,点击设置界面按钮,相当于保存确定操作。

5、双击刚才我们建立的文本框,可以自动跳转到脚本界面,并且还会自动写两行代码,代码里面就可以对输入框进行操作了。

6、直接用Excel表格进行测试,读取一个测试Excel表格的数据。将制定文档的数据读取到椭圆所框选的地方,就是文本输入框里面。接下来调试看看。

7、按蓝色小圈的步骤一步步的点击,就会出现这样的效果,Excel是小编自己主动打开的,便于对比,实际脚本运行过程中,指定文档是不会在桌面被打开的。

lwy106094
推荐于2017-11-24 · TA获得超过1088个赞
知道小有建树答主
回答量:792
采纳率:25%
帮助的人:292万
展开全部
Form1.InputBox1.Text 用这个可以取到按键精灵界面里的控件值
Form1是窗体名字,默认生成的就是这个名字
InputBox1 是输入框的名字
Text 输入框的文本内容
例如 文本框里的内容是20那么代码就可以这么写
forcount = Form1.InputBox1.Text
For i=forcount to 100
SayString CStr(i)
Delay 200
KeyPress "Enter", 1
Next
本回答被提问者采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式